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7761450001 578922 53518490 89708934624 788352
1653558177 1006992934 063062290
1653558177 1006992934 063062290
6304888853 986315 06853
All about undefined
Interested in learning more?
1653558177 1006992934 063062290
6304888853 986315 06853
See more
2737983 2891149
59218 29832 08658075392 166098
See more
277901 419
04 013 19 09111203 8512752
See more